Produktbeschreibung
Do you need a breakthrough? Are you stuck fighting the same battles with kids who seem totally unmotivated to change? The truth is, every child is motivated, you just need to learn how to unlock your child's unique heart. In Start with the Heart, you'll learn practical, manageable strategies for motivating your kids toward healthy life habits, including how to: * Address beliefs that affect behavior * Respond to consistent complaining * Increase resiliency and decrease fear of hard work * Listen longer and teach your kids to know themselves * Create change that lasts long-term Plus, Dr. Koch will teach you what really irritates kids (they've told her), and how to identify and avoid actions that break down trust. Move your kids from "I Can't" to "I Can, I Will, I Did." Autorenporträt
KATHY KOCH ("cook"), PhD, is the founder and president of Celebrate Kids, Inc., a Christian ministry based in Fort Worth, Texas. She is an internationally celebrated speaker who has influenced thousands of parents, teachers, and children in over 25 countries through keynote messages, workshops, assemblies, and other events.
